Wedding fairs are a good place to start. You can get a feel for what's on the market, various styles and price estimates. We went to a handful before discussing ideas, then pinpointed our venue, photographer, videographer and register (only because our venue doesn't offer one). Online is great- lots of the venues have prices on there and others you have to contact them to find out which is worth doing as you dont want to go to the venue and fall in love with it and then find out its way over budget.
Pinterest is great for ideas too
